Discover the thought-provoking insights of Paul Edward Gottfried in his compelling book, After Liberalism, published by Princeton in 2001. This engaging analysis delves into the decline of nineteenth-century liberalism, examining how the rise of the managerial state has transformed political landscapes. With a focus on the implications of this shift, Gottfried argues that contemporary regimes, led by social engineers, are characterized by elitism and a unique form of consensual governance—one that lacks significant organized opposition.
